    Hot New Business in Pauoa, Honolulu, Hawaii... Open Mondays through Saturdays from 11am to 7:30pm, Alejandro's Mexican Food finally started to feed its loyal customers on Monday, February 16, 2026. Alejandro's first location is deep in Kalihi Valley and it's still thriving. We had a small party there with friends a while ago... Alejandro branched out to Kapahulu where I got ROTD (Review of the Day) many years ago. Unfortunately, that location closed down. The third location is in Pearl City - I still need to go there... This fourth location is in a quiet neighborhood. It took the place of Pauoa Chop Suey, on the corner of Pauoa Road and Pacific Heights Road. Service is super welcoming, helpful, and friendly! Alejandro is such a wonderful, gregarious person! You can't help but like him instantly... his smile and Aloha Spirit are infectious! The environment is like heaven if you're a Dodgers and/or Lakers fan! Check out the murals and take a photo with your favorite star! Note the stickers on the backs of the chairs... RIP Kobe! Of course, the food is authentic Mexican! I had the #2 Taco Combination Plate: chicken, pork (carnitas), and steak (carne asada) that comes with a drink! I got a refreshing horchata which is cinnamon and rice water - it was rich and tasty... not watered down! The steak was tender; the chicken was moist; and the pork was delicious! Parking is free behind the building. There are eight stalls. If they're full, park on the street! You'll find a way! It's worth it!

    Probably one of the top 5 best Mexican food restaurants in Hawai'i. Easy. Let's start with the parking. There is limited parking in the rear of the building along the fenceline, shared with residential. The access is very narrow (1 car width, height restriction 6'2") from both Pauoa and Pacific Heights Roads, so be very careful when turning in and exiting out. Good luck finding street parking. Once inside, you'll see impressive murials of a few current and popular Dodger and Laker players. The staff is friendly, you're greeted upon entering and thanked as you depart. The menu is pretty impressive, although prices seem a bit up there, especially if you add toppings. We got the chicken nachos and wet carne asada burrito plate with avocado. You can choose plain avocado or guacamole, I chose the latter. Although, after halfway through my meal, I think they forgot to give it to me because I didn't see any. Regardless, you get a decent amount of food. I ate everything on my plate in maybe 10 minutes, it was so good. I seriously considered buying another burrito plate, but decided against it, despondently. The nachos were very good too. Didn't know we can byob. I'm pretty sure we'll be back.

    Alejandro's!! Tasty food, friendly atmosphere! Multiple choices of salsa to add to your food! No booze, but BYOB appears OK. Parking: Around 5-7 stalls available behind the building on makai side (don't steal the apartment dwellers' stalls on mauka side!) Two parking entrances: One on Pauoa Rd side, right where Pali Hwy flies over, the second is on Pacific Hts Rd side of building, nearer the corner. WARNING: the Pacific Hts entrance is only 6'2" high, and guests of the previous business there have had too-tall autos get scraped!
